The original demo had a larger basis in Freespace. When you used the autopilot, it would use time-compression to get you to the next waypoint rather than the "fly-by cutscene" that Wing Commander traditionally used. From what I've seen of the newer demo, they went to the "fly-by" and did some work on the interface as well to streamline it. Most of the real work on this project has been completed in the past two years. My understanding is that they've had the script largely completed for almost five. It's a fan project, and from what I've seen, the love for the original is in every byte. Given how so many people have been jonesing for a new Wing Commander fix, they'd rake in the cash if they could get the rights to it.
